NGO Urges Anambra Government to Rehabilitate Juvenile Offenders

The Anti-Kidnapping, Human Trafficking, Child Abuse, and Drug Abuse Initiative (AKH-TRACADA), an NGO, has appealed to the Anambra State Government to urgently rehabilitate juvenile offenders.

The call was made by Mr. Belonwu Ezeanyaeche, Executive Director of the NGO, in a statement issued in Abuja Wednesday.

He responded to a widely trending video on which nine children were in detention for offences such as burglary, stealing, drug abuse, and robbery.

Ezeanyaeche attributed the increase in youth crime to factors such as broken homes, parental lack of guidance, peer influence, and drug abuse.

He added that if not checked, such children would find themselves becoming streetwise criminals or militant/terrorist group members who recruit others.

To stem the trend, he proposed a multi-strategy comprising rehabilitation programs and occupational skill training.
